Penn State to Host Youth Clinic During NCAA Women's Volleyball Regionals

Nov. 26, 2010

Complete Release in PDF Format

UNIVERSITY PARK, Pa. - In conjunction with the 2010 NCAA Division I Women's Volleyball Regional hosted by Penn State, the NCAA and American Volleyball Coaches Association (AVCA) will host a Powerade Youth Volleyball Clinic on Dec. 11 from 3:30-5 p.m. in the South Gym of Rec Hall.

Youth, ages 8-12, of all ability levels are invited to join the NCAA and AVCA for an opportunity to develop fundamental playing skills, as well as learn to play and communicate as part of a team. Check-in is at 3 p.m. The youth clinic, which will include instruction from collegiate coaches, is free of charge and limited to the first 175 participants.

Penn State is one of four host sites for the 2010 NCAA Women's Volleyball Regional Championships on Dec. 10-11. The three-time defending national champion Nittany Lions have hosted at least one round of the NCAA Tournament in 23 of the possible 29 years, including the last 20 consecutive seasons. Penn State has played 46 NCAA matches in the confines of Rec Hall since 1981 and boasts an impressive 43-3 record. Rec Hall has played host to the Regional Championships in 1997, 1998, 1999, 2005, 2007 and 2008.

The Regional Semifinal matches are set for 5 p.m. and 7 p.m. on Friday, Dec. 10 in Rec Hall. The Regional Final match will be played at 6:30 p.m. on Saturday, Dec. 11. All-session tickets are available by calling 814-865-5555 at a cost of $16 for adults and $10 for youth and students.
